Square Enix is Releasing a Big Game Between April 2019 and March 2020


Square Enix started their 2019 with a bang, thanks to the release of Kingdom Hearts 3, a game that fans have been waiting more than a literal decade for. The company has a number of other games that are coming out this year, including a few Final Fantasy ports for the Switch and Xbox One, but fans are wondering if any major titles will be coming from good old SE. Well, it seems like we are getting a major game release, we just don't know what.

According to the company's third-quarter earnings, there will be a major game that comes out between April 2019 and March 2020. This big-name game will either get announced during E3 or the lead up to this event, which will be interesting since Sony won't be partaking in the big occasion. If the game is announced during E3, we can only hope that the title comes out within the year.

One game everyone is hoping to see released is the highly-anticipated Final Fantasy VII remake. The game will be directed by Tetsuya "Kingdom Hearts" Nomura, so expect a fun combat system and stylish character designs. This game has got everyone's interest since there have been reports that the remake will spawn multiple titles, with previous rumors saying that it would be episodic.

Then there's the mysterious Avengers Project, which still has no details. All we know is that this will be the first Marvel game coming from Square Enix and we're all hoping it will blow our socks off. With Marvel Ultimate Alliance 3 coming to the Nintendo Switch this summer, it's safe to assume that this will be different from the acclaimed beat-em-up RPG.
